Respectfully Asking for Your Vote
Michael F. Magistrali is Judge of Probate for Torrington and Goshen. With election day just around the corner, I’d like to take this opportunity to greet the voters of Torrington and Goshen and ask for their support on November 5. For the past four years, I’ve had the privilege of serving as Probate Judge for the Torrington District. During that time, I’ve worked to make the Court as user-friendly as possible, by hiring knowledgeable, friendly clerks who are eager to help and by keeping the Court open through the lunch hour to make it more accessible for more people. I’ve also reached out to the community to educate people about the work done by the Probate Court, by speaking before numerous organizations and sponsoring programs at the Sullivan Senior Center. Most importantly, I’ve worked hard to serve you as best I could as your Probate Judge. After a court visit this past July, the Chief Counsel for the Probate Administrator, who oversees the operation of all the probate courts in the state, wrote in her report that: "The Judge and staff make every effort to serve the people of the district in a timely and efficient manner. The staff is friendly, courteous and helpful. The court is exceptionally well run and well organized. The people of Torrington and Goshen are well served by the Judge and the staff of this court."
